Here is two questions -

1. What is the best way to deal with the problem area around the back window at the bottom? Mine is so rusted that when I removed the trim, most of the clips holding it came with it. I think the previous owner just painted over the rust! graemlins/angry.gif It is now also leaking into the trunk.

2. Where do I need to begin looking if water is leaking into the passenger floorboard? My carpet is all molded and ruined now. Will have to replace once bodywork and paint are done.

Mine has the same problem. I think the previous owner parked it under a pine tree for awhile because when I took out the rear window there were pine needles in the window seal glue. The remnents are a 4" X 4" hole on near the lower left window frame and a piece of vinyl siding riveted into place to hold the rear deck to the window frame section.
I called Goodmark and ordered a new deck filler panel for like $80. I fills the whole section that holds the rear window with new metal and its pretty reasonably priced. No more vinyl siding either!
The rusted area may not be sealed thus causing your water problem in the rear interior section.
